About Renaissance Faires in Illinois
Illinois is home to 8 Renaissance faires and medieval festivals across cities including Chicago, South Elgin, Crystal Lake and 4 more. The state offers a diverse mix of events including Renaissance faires, fairy festivals. Faire season in Illinois runs during summer, fall, giving visitors plenty of opportunities to experience period entertainment, artisan crafts, and immersive historical fun.
Top-rated faires in Illinois include Frostmoon Faire (4.8/5), Faire in the Field (4.7/5) and Faeries of the Forest Festival (4.7/5), located in Crystal Lake. Whether you're a first-timer or a seasoned faire-goer, Illinois has something for every Renaissance enthusiast.
